2017 ETB to AFN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017
During 2017, the ETB to AFN ex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 7, valuing the pair at 2.9890.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 26, dropping to 2.4979.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.4911 AFN.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2.9578 to the December average rate of 2.5306, the exchange rate registered a net change of -14.45%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 2.9890 was down 8.47% compared to the 2016 peak of 3.2654,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

ETB to AFN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is
A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.
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 2.9489, compared to 2.7474 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.2015 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2017 was October, with a trading range of 0.4097 AFN (High: 2.9076 / Low: 2.4979). On the other end, December was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0334 AFN (High: 2.5454 / Low: 2.5120).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ween March and May,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 2 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between September and October, when the average rate fell by 0.2647 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(February 2017: 2.9472) against the same month in 2016 (average: 3.2305), the exchange rate shifted by -0.2833 (-8.77%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 2.9799 | 2.9297 | 2.9578 |
| February | 2.9890 | 2.9224 | 2.9472 |
| March | 2.9586 | 2.9096 | 2.9341 |
| April | 2.9745 | 2.9268 | 2.9502 |
| May | 2.9715 | 2.9206 | 2.9559 |
| June | 2.9747 | 2.9206 | 2.9485 |
| July | 2.9598 | 2.9224 | 2.9379 |
| August | 2.9694 | 2.9059 | 2.9337 |
| September | 2.9378 | 2.8967 | 2.9166 |
| October | 2.9076 | 2.4979 | 2.6519 |
| November | 2.5364 | 2.5013 | 2.5139 |
| December | 2.5454 | 2.5120 | 2.5306 |
